1969 Chevrolet Camaro RS/SS Convertible — Big Block 496 V8, TH400, Frame Connectors, Coilovers Why This Car Is Special The 1969 Chevrolet Camaro is widely regarded as the pinnacle of the first-generation platform. Chevrolet redesigned the body for 1969, giving it a lower, wider, more aggressive stance compared to the 1967–68 cars, and the market responded — 1969 remains the highest-production year of the first-gen Camaro, with more than 243,000 units built. Within that production run, the RS/SS convertible combination was one of the most optioned and most desirable configurations a buyer could order. The Rally Sport package (RPO Z22) added the iconic hideaway headlight system, a blacked-out grille with RS badging, and body-color bumper fillers, while the Super Sport package (RPO Z27) brought the big-block drivetrain, SS badges, and the hockey stick body stripe. Ordering both on a convertible, with a big-block engine, put this car at or near the top of the Camaro option sheet in 1969. The VIN on this car decodes to a Norwood, Ohio assembly plant build — the 'N' in the seventh position confirms that. Norwood was one of two Camaro assembly facilities in 1969, and it produced the majority of first-gen Camaros. The body style code '67' in the VIN confirms the convertible body, and the engine code '8' indicates this car left the factory with a big-block V8. The original factory color, confirmed by the trim tag, is Hugger Orange — GM paint code 72, one of the signature colors of the muscle car era and one of the most recognized Camaro colors from the 1969 model year. What makes this particular 1969 Camaro RS/SS Convertible stand out beyond its credentials is the scope of the mechanical work done to it. The original drivetrain has been replaced with a Blueprint Engines 496 cubic inch big-block crate engine sourced through Summit Racing, rated by the builder at 600 horsepower.
